Wellness check turns up 3 loaded firearms, cash and suspected drugs

Wellness check turns up 3 loaded firearms, cash and suspected drugs The Daily Jeffersonian A wellness check request for a motorist at a Cambridge gas station Tuesday led to the discovery of suspected narcotics, three firearms and a significant amount of cash by city police officers. Two of the guns including a handgun mounted under the vehicle s dash were loaded. Another loaded handgun was found in a bag on the passenger seat. Officers charged the driver, Donald W. McCarty III, 34, of Inwood, West Virginia, with one count each of improper handling a firearm in a motor vehicle, a fourth-degree felony, and aggravated possession of drugs, a fifth-degree felony.

Pair facing felony drug charges after arrest by CODE agents, deputies

Pair facing felony drug charges after arrest by CODE agents, deputies The Daily Jeffersonian Preliminary hearings have been scheduled for two Cambridge residents facing felony drug charges following an investigation by the Central Ohio Drug Enforcement Task Force and Guernsey County Sheriff s Office last week. Brittany Gardner, 27, and Tyson Heskett, 22, were arrested by authorities on April 19 after a search warrant was executed at a Cambridge residence. The preliminary hearings are scheduled for May 6 in the Cambridge Municipal Court. Gardner faces single counts of permitting drug abuse and aggravated possession of drugs, fifth-degree felonies, while Heskett is charged with aggravated possession of drugs and possession of a fentanyl-related compound, also fifth-degree felonies.

16-year-old girl fatally shot by Columbus police as nation awaited verdict in Chauvin trial

16-year-old girl fatally shot by Columbus police as nation awaited verdict in Chauvin trial [INSERT CAPTION HERE] (Source: Storyblocks) By Stephanie Czekalinski | April 20, 2021 at 8:23 PM CDT - Updated April 20 at 10:26 PM COLUMBUS, Ohio (WOIO) - Media outlets across Central Ohio are reporting that a 16-year-old girl was shot and killed by Columbus police as the nation waited for the verdict in the murder trial of Derek Chauvin, the former Minneapolis police officer who killed George Floyd. The shooting occurred after 4:30 p.m. on Columbus’s Southeast Side, according to sister station WBNS. Columbus Mayor Andrew Ginther said the loss of life was a tragedy and called for calm in a post on Twitter. He said that there is body camera footage and the Ohio Bureau of Criminal Identification and Investigation was investigating.
